Browning and foxing, spine titles faded, bumping and scratching to corners and edges. Born in Nova Scotia, Day won a Rhodes Scholarship, studying at Oxford in 1905. He served in the 185th Canadian Infantry Battalion during the First World War. Following injuries, he retired with his family to the village of Lake Annis in Yarmouth County, NS, where Day spent his time fishing, hunting and paddling the water ways of Yarmouth County. Concentrating very much on his love of fishing, this book recounts his childhood and youth exploring the waters around him, learning how to fly fish from experienced locals, and then his post-war fishing experiences with old friends and his child. The book resonates with his love for the Novia Scotia landscape and the fishing opportunties it presents. "The reader sees him through his final episode of fishing with his father before his father dies, as well as the First World War, during which time he 'never wet a line', and beyond, as he marries, builds a family, and continues to fish. Day's reflections suggest the restorative powers of the environment and should appeal to even those readers who have never thought to sit quietly by the side of a stream, line in hand, waiting." .

Day was born in 1881 in Shubenacadie, Nova Scotia, he attended Pictou Academy and later Mount Allison Univ where in 1903 he obtained a BA and a Rhodes Scholarship. Upon leaving Oxford Univ he traveled briefly in Germany and soon after took a teaching position at the University of New Brunswick (1909-1912). In 1912 he moved to the Carnegie Institute and later to Swathmore College. Upon the outbreak of WW l he returned to Canada enlisting in the 185th Cape Breton Highlanders where he gained a field promotion to colonel.
